** The Volvo repair market for Whigham, GA residents is entirely dependent on service providers in neighboring cities. There are no Volvo-specific specialists located within Whigham itself. The market is characterized by a tiered structure: * **Average Quality:** The quality is high among the few dedicated specialists. The closest options in Thomasville, GA, and Tallahassee, FL, offer expertise that rivals or exceeds what is available in larger Georgian cities like Albany. * **Competition Level:** Competition is moderate. While there are only a handful of true specialists, they compete on a regional level. Customers choose between a premium-priced official dealership (Keystone) for the highest level of factory support and lower-priced, highly competent independents (Thomasville Imports, Swedish Motors). * **Typical Pricing:** Pricing follows the standard model for European car repair. The official dealership (Keystone) commands the highest labor rates and parts costs. The independent specialists typically offer labor rates 20-30% lower than the dealership, making them a strong value proposition for out-of-warranty vehicles. A standard service like an oil change on a T6 engine may range from $150-$250, while complex diagnostics or transmission service can run from $500 to $1,500+ depending on the shop and the issue.
